How Our Team Removes Pinhole Leaks: A Step-by-Step Guide
A proper Pinhole Leak Water Removal process needs precision and expertise. Our team uses specialized equipment to detect hidden leaks and water damage. We’ll explain what happens in each step, so you know exactly what to expect.
Step 1: Containment and Drying
We’ll set up containment barriers to prevent water from spreading to other areas of your home. Our team uses specialized equipment to dry the affected area quickly and efficiently, reducing damage and preventing mold growth. Within 60 minutes, we’ll have the area contained and drying.
Step 2: Leak Detection
Our technicians use th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ters to detect hidden leaks and water dam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ak and create a plan to repair it. Our team has years of experience with Pinhole Leak Water Removal, so you can trust us to get it right.
Step 3: Leak Repair
We’ll repair or replace the affected pipes, fixtures, or appliances to prevent further leaks. Our team uses high-quality materials and follows industry standards to ensure a watertight seal. You can expect a 3-5 day turnaround for this step, depending on the complexity of the repair.
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the leak is repaired, we’ll focus on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. Our team uses indust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th. This step typ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Our team will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free of any remaining water damage. We’ll clean and disinfect the area to prevent mold growth and leave your home smelling fresh and clean. You can expect a 1-2 day turnaround for this step.

Warning Signs You Need Pinhole Leak Water Removal
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Catching them early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ice persistent musty smells in your home,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it, call us to investigate and repair the issue before it gets worse.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a pinhole leak. If you notice them, don’t assume it’s just a minor issue, it could be a sign of more extensive dam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ice it, don’t delay, call us to inspect and repair the issue before it gets worse.
Unexplained Increases in Water Bills
If your water bills are suddenly higher than usual, it may be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it, call us to investigate and repair the issue before it gets worse.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
If you notice visible signs of water damage, such as water spots, mineral deposits, or discoloration, don’t delay, call us to inspect and repair the issue before it gets worse.
Unpleasant Sounds or Creaks
Unpleasant sounds or creaks from your pipes or walls can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it, call us to investigate and repair the issue before it gets worse.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al Cost in Monroe, WA
The cost of Pinhole Leak Water Removal varies dep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ience with similar projects in Monroe, WA.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Containment and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area and number of containment barriers needed. |
| Leak Detection and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Complexity of the repair and number of pipes or fixtures affected.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area and number of dehumidifiers needed. |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area and level of cleaning required.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and flexible payment plans to make our services more accessible to homeowners in Monroe, WA.
